Project Details

Shrewsberry’s Landscape Architecture and Site Civil Team is responsible for all exterior site improvements for the renovation of Indianapolis’ Gainbridge Fieldhouse. The Bicentennial Unity Plaze features carefully selected materials, innovative pavement designs, and thoughtfully integrated plaza spaces with curated edge treatments, seat walls, and furniture; the plaza embodies accessibility with ADA-compliant pedestrian walkways and public comfort zones.

The expanded and re-envisioned exterior plaza and the new entry pavilion form connections with surrounding pedestrian areas, such as the Cultural Trail, the Transit Center, and Georgia Street. The plaza is an amenity on game days and a community asset year-round. The design utilizes the sunken foundation of the demolished parking garage as the perimeter for a tiered gathering area, accommodating basketball, concerts, and events in warmer months and a skating rink in colder months. Adjacent areas of the plaza include terraced seating, opportunities for pop-up retail and dining, and improved access to the Team Store and arena offerings. The Bicentennial Unity Plaza at Gainbridge Fieldhouse is more than an event space. It’s an amenity that connects downtown Indianapolis and serves as a backdrop for incredible experiences for visitors and residents.

The Bicentennial Unity Plaza at Gainbridge won the Honor Award for Landscape Architecture at the 2024 Monumental Awards Celebration, presented by the Indy Chamber. This annual recognition celebrates the individuals and businesses contributing to excellence in the Central Indiana built environment.
